vaccination began, more than 150,000 people had received the corona vaccine until yesterday (the 3rd). We are investigating the cause.

All of them had underlying diseases, and the authorities repeatedly emphasized that those with underlying diseases are in principle the subject of priority vaccination.

additional deaths after vaccination were 2 males in their 50s and 1 female in their 20s.



Two patients in their 50s were patients in nursing hospitals, and those in their 20s were in severely handicapped facilities. The regions were different in Buan, Jeonju, and Daejeon in Jeollabuk-do, and the time to death after vaccination was 15 hours, 41 hours, and 42 hours.



Health authorities are currently investigating the cause of death, and it has been confirmed that all five people who died after vaccination had underlying diseases.



[Eun-hee Cho/Head of Post-Vaccination Management Team, Vaccination Response Promotion Group: Yesterday, we received a report as normal about the objective signs we can see for two deaths.] There was



also a case of anaphylaxis shock that showed shortness of breath 10 minutes after vaccination.



A patient in her 50s in a nursing hospital, recovered after receiving an injection that boosts blood pressure and heart rate.



Health officials have emphasized that the flu vaccine as well as the corona 19 vaccine have been classified as priority targets for people with underlying diseases in most countries, including us.



The vaccine prevents infection and prevents serious progression, so don't be afraid to get vaccinated, as the benefits of vaccination are greater than the damage if it didn't work.



AstraZeneca vaccination has begun in medical institutions above the hospital level.



At Seoul National University Hospital, most of the staff, including medical staff and cooks, get this vaccine, but the hospital director came out as the first inoculation.



[Kim Yeon-su/Director of Seoul National University Hospital: It is most important to get rid of unfounded mistrust or anxiety, and if necessary, I said that I would get it first.]



President Moon Jae-in said he would be willing to get the AstraZeneca vaccine, the Blue House said.



It was explained that it contained a message that the people could get the vaccine with confidence, but it seems that the vaccination will be done within this month, taking into account the Korea Centers for Disease Control and Prevention manual and diplomatic schedule.
